Nearly seven million Latinos in the U.S. provide unpaid care to an aging or older loved one. Many Latino family caregivers see caregiving responsibilities simply as something family members do for one another, and do not seek outside help.
Today the face of the Latino caregiver is changing. In this Prepare to Care Podcast, Dr. Jacqueline Angel, professor of public affairs and sociology at the University of Texas at Austin, talked to host Charlene Hunter James. Dr. Angel discusses the change in the Latino Caregiver and what it means.
